**** update-checker
|
||||
:PROPERTIES:
|
||||
:CUSTOM_ID: h:4d864147-f9ef-46da-9b4f-4e7996a65157
|
||||
:END:
|
||||
|
||||
This utility checks if there are updated packages in nixpkgs-unstable. It does so by fully building the most recent configuration, which I do not love, but it has its merits once I am willing to switch to the newer version.
|
||||
|
||||
#+begin_src shell :tangle scripts/update-checker.sh
|
||||
updates="$({ cd /home/swarsel/.dotfiles && nix flake lock --update-input nixpkgs && nix build .#nixosConfigurations."$(eval hostname)".config.system.build.toplevel && nvd diff /run/current-system ./result | grep -c '\[U'; } || true)"
|
||||
|
||||
alt="has-updates"
|
||||
if [[ $updates -eq 0 ]]; then
|
||||
alt="updated"
|
||||
fi
|
||||
|
||||
tooltip="System updated"
|
||||
if [[ $updates != 0 ]]; then
|
||||
tooltip=$(cd ~/.dotfiles && nvd diff /run/current-system ./result | grep -e '\[U' | awk '{ for (i=3; i<NF; i++) printf $i " "; if (NF >= 3) print $NF; }' ORS='\\n')
|
||||
echo "{ \"text\":\"$updates\", \"alt\":\"$alt\", \"tooltip\":\"$tooltip\" }"
|
||||
else
|
||||
echo "{ \"text\":\"\", \"alt\":\"$alt\", \"tooltip\":\"\" }"
|
||||
fi
|
||||
#+end_src
|
||||
|
||||
#+begin_src nix :tangle pkgs/update-checker/default.nix
|
||||
{ self, name, writeShellApplication, nvd }:
|
||||
writeShellApplication {
|
||||
inherit name;
|
||||
runtimeInputs = [ nvd ];
|
||||
text = builtins.readFile "${self}/scripts/${name}.sh";
|
||||
}
|
||||
#+end_src
